The Jamaica Basic Schools Foundation raises £3k with fun run

RAISNG FUNDS: Fun Run/Walk participants express their enjoyment

THE JAMAICA Basic Schools Foundation (UK) staged its third annual 10K Fun Run/Walk in Crystal Palace Park, south London recently.

The Fun Run/Walk was in aid of the charity’s on-going efforts to assist basic schools in Jamaica.

JBSF founder Josephine Williams-Brown said the turnout of participants was overwhelming and many have pledged their support for next year. This year’s Fun Run/Walk raised over £3,000.

After the walk, everyone was treated with a free breakfast courtesy of Grace Foods UK, one of JBCF’s key sponsors. The event was also sponsored by Victoria Mutual, National Bakery and Sun Land.

The next event on the JBSF’s calendar will be the annual Family Fun Day and Food Festival on Sunday, August 7 also at Crystal Palace Park to mark Jamaica’s 54th Independence celebrations. Attractions will be food stalls, musical entertainment, featuring Stephen McGregor and Chino McGregor, arts and craft, fun fair and bouncy castle for children. The event will start at 12.30 pm and finish at 7.30 pm.
